He burrows 6 holes in 2 minutes which means that he can burrow 3 holes in 1 minute.
To determine how many he can burrow in 7 minutes, you would multiply the
unit rate of 3 holes in 1 minute by 7.
He would burrow 21 holes in 7 minutes.
